Output 63eda9af955afe67a08b6615f4c8e5c1ca78605d31f07e451f512e76d814162c:8

value
50792107
script pubkey
OP_0 OP_PUSHBYTES_20 007258c35961f1aa3dfc7a16e53fb2c86b98df0e
address
bc1qqpe93s6ev8c6500u0gtw20ajep4e3hcwqt9chy
transaction
63eda9af955afe67a08b6615f4c8e5c1ca78605d31f07e451f512e76d814162c
spent
true